Transaction 66d79c3e3012a389cd4b2b1494dc9998aa1148bb76af2ae04964b76828aae958

1 Input
2 Outputs
  • 66d79c3e3012a389cd4b2b1494dc9998aa1148bb76af2ae04964b76828aae958:0
  • value  14896647
    address  1GiXzj3ymt2mkKvBJQBuygedEJYveJZutX
  • 66d79c3e3012a389cd4b2b1494dc9998aa1148bb76af2ae04964b76828aae958:1
  • value  1229872194
    address  1LcMuAH4fXxRDEpk6LtB1pXcyio9RRqiqQ